LOL. That reminds me of back when the Russian space station Mir was still up. Their routine chat downlink freq. they used for routine comms just happened to be on the same freq. as a local EMO (Emergency Measures Organization) repeater output at 148.235 MHz. I had lots of EMO members asking WTF the comms were on their freq. I would tune my ham gear to their up/down links whenever I heard Russian starting to break the squelch on the scanner.
